Transaction 42d43818c8d142c58845eb88dd5ebb06d3932316b31facbff284d75f64f75fac
1 Input
2 Outputs
- 42d43818c8d142c58845eb88dd5ebb06d3932316b31facbff284d75f64f75fac:0
- 42d43818c8d142c58845eb88dd5ebb06d3932316b31facbff284d75f64f75fac:1
value 96484
address 1DdcKF5zTRXar7F8VrTfv5BJRjcjb1ASVw
value 1880000
address 1949h7k79wsH8CN5c2SWi5ms3MVzYQUeyg